Packers (6-6) at Giants (4-8)
Monday, 8:15 p.m. ET, MetLife Stadium, East Rutherford, New Jersey
TV: ABC
Spread (BetMGM):
Packers by 6.5
Packers’ keys to victory: Create explosive plays in the passing game and protect the football. The Packers’ recent surge on offense has been fueled by big plays. QB Jordan Love has been more accurate down the field and the young WRs, including Christian Watson and Jayden Reed, have made more plays. Love must hit explosive plays against a Giants defense giving up about 7 yards per pass attempt. Taking care of the ball is also vital. The Giants produced nine total takeaways in back-toback wins over the Commanders and Patriots. Can Love find a balance between big plays and avoiding turnovers?
Giants’ keys to victory: Dominate the line of scrimmage on both sides. Getting RB Saquon Barkley going is vital, but so is protecting young QB Tommy DeVito. The offensive line must play its best game of the season. Defensively, the Giants must take away the Packers run game and force Love into a one-dimensional offense. The defensive front must produce sacks to end drives and pressure to create takeaway opportunities in obvious passing situations.
Matchup to watch: Packers LG Elgton Jenkins vs. Giants DL Dexter Lawrence: Finally over a knee injury, Jenkins will be tasked with keeping Lawrence – one of the most disruptive interior defenders in football – from taking over the contest.
Who wins? The Giants are at home and coming off the bye, but the Packers are the more wellrounded team on both sides of the ball.
Packers, 23-10
